Types of Elephant are among the largest and most recognizable land mammals in the world, but not all elephants are the same. Today, three living elephant species are recognized: the African Savanna Elephant, African Forest Elephant, and Asian Elephant. The Asian Elephant also includes several recognized subspecies or regional forms, including the Indian, Sri Lankan, Sumatran, and Bornean elephants. This guide explains these elephant types, their scientific classification, appearance, geographic range, habitat, behavior, diet, and conservation status.
How Many Types of Elephants Are There?
There are three living elephant species recognized today. Two belong to Africa—the African Savanna Elephant and African Forest Elephant—while the Asian Elephant is the third species. The commonly discussed forms are the Indian Elephant, Sri Lankan Elephant, Sumatran Elephant, and Bornean Elephant.

Elephant Behavior and Social Life
Elephants are highly social mammals with complex relationships. Female elephants commonly live in family groups, while adult males may become more independent as they mature. Family groups can cooperate in caring for young animals and moving between feeding and water areas. Their trunks are extremely versatile and are used for breathing, smelling, touching, drinking, feeding, and handling objects.

African Bush Elephant
The African bush elephant is the largest living land animal and is scientifically known as Loxodonta africana. It is found mainly in savannas, grasslands, woodlands, and other habitats across sub-Saharan Africa. It has large ears, a long trunk, and curved tusks. African bush elephants live in family groups and mainly eat grasses, leaves, bark, fruits, and other vegetation.
African Forest Elephant
The African forest elephant is scientifically known as Loxodonta cyclotis and is smaller than the African bush elephant. It lives mainly in the tropical forests of Central and West Africa. It has relatively rounded ears and straighter, downward-pointing tusks. Forest elephants play an important ecological role by spreading seeds and creating pathways through dense vegetation while searching for leaves, fruits, and other plant foods.
Asian Elephant | Types of Elephant
The Asian elephant is scientifically known as Elephas maximus and is the largest land animal in Asia. It occurs in parts of South and Southeast Asia, including forests, grasslands, and scrublands. Asian elephants generally have smaller ears than African elephants, and usually only males develop large visible tusks. They are herbivores that feed on grasses, leaves, bark, fruits, roots, and other vegetation.
Indian Elephant
The Indian elephant is a population of the Asian elephant, Elephas maximus, found mainly in mainland South Asia. It occurs across India and neighboring regions and inhabits forests, grasslands, wetlands, and cultivated landscapes. Indian elephants have smaller, rounded ears compared with African elephants. They are highly social herbivores that travel in family groups and consume grasses, leaves, bark, fruits, roots, and crops.
Sri Lankan Elephant
The Sri Lankan elephant is a subspecies of Asian elephant, scientifically known as Elephas maximus maximus. It is native to Sri Lanka and is generally considered the largest of the Asian elephant subspecies. It has a dark gray to brownish skin, often with lighter patches on the face, ears, trunk, and belly. These elephants live in forests, grasslands, and dry-zone habitats and feed mainly on plants.
Sumatran Elephant
The Sumatran elephant is a subspecies of Asian elephant, scientifically known as Elephas maximus sumatranus. It is native to the Indonesian island of Sumatra, where it inhabits forests and other areas with suitable vegetation and water. Sumatran elephants are generally smaller than African elephants and have relatively smaller ears. They are herbivores that eat grasses, leaves, bark, fruits, roots, and other plant material.
Bornean Elephant
The Bornean elephant is a population of Asian elephants found on the island of Borneo, particularly in northeastern Sabah, Malaysia. It is often called the Bornean pygmy elephant because of its relatively small body size, although its evolutionary history is complex. These elephants live in forests and nearby habitats and feed on grasses, leaves, fruits, bark, and other vegetation. They are threatened by habitat loss and fragmentation.
Woolly Mammoth | Types of Elephant
The woolly mammoth was an extinct elephant relative scientifically known as Mammuthus primigenius. It lived across northern Eurasia and North America during the Ice Age and was adapted to cold environments. Its body was covered with long hair and dense underfur, while its small ears helped reduce heat loss. Woolly mammoths had large curved tusks and mainly ate grasses, herbs, and other tundra vegetation.
Columbian Mammoth
The Columbian mammoth was an extinct species scientifically known as Mammuthus columbi. It lived in North America during the Pleistocene and occupied a variety of environments, including grasslands and open woodland. It was generally larger than the woolly mammoth and had less extensive body hair because it lived in warmer regions. Columbian mammoths had large tusks and mainly consumed grasses, herbs, and other vegetation.
Steppe Mammoth
The steppe mammoth was an extinct species known scientifically as Mammuthus trogontherii. It lived across parts of Eurasia during the Pleistocene and was adapted to open, cold grassland environments. It was a very large mammoth, with long, curved tusks and a massive body. Its diet consisted mainly of grasses and other plants available in steppe habitats. It was an important herbivore in prehistoric ecosystems.
Southern Mammoth
The southern mammoth was an extinct elephant relative scientifically known as Mammuthus meridionalis. It lived during the early and middle Pleistocene across parts of Europe and Asia. It was among the earlier members of the mammoth lineage and had large, curved tusks. Compared with later Ice Age mammoths, it was less adapted to extremely cold conditions. It mainly fed on grasses, leaves, and other vegetation.
Imperial Mammoth
The imperial mammoth was an extinct mammoth species scientifically known as Mammuthus imperator. It lived in North America during the Pleistocene and was one of the largest known mammoths. It had a massive body, long legs, and large curved tusks. Imperial mammoths inhabited relatively open landscapes and fed on grasses, herbs, shrubs, and other vegetation. Fossil remains have been discovered in several parts of North America.
Dwarf Mammoth
Dwarf mammoths were small-bodied mammoths that evolved on islands where limited resources encouraged smaller body sizes. One well-known example is the Channel Islands pygmy mammoth, Mammuthus exilis, which lived on islands off the coast of California. It descended from larger mainland mammoths and became much smaller over generations. This island dwarfism is an example of evolutionary adaptation to restricted habitats and limited food resources.
Straight-Tusked Elephant
The straight-tusked elephant was an extinct elephant species scientifically known as Palaeoloxodon antiquus. It lived across Europe and parts of western Asia during the Pleistocene. Unlike modern elephants, it had long, relatively straight tusks and a very large body. It inhabited forests, open woodland, and other temperate environments. Its diet included leaves, grasses, branches, fruits, and other plant material available in its habitat.
Palaeoloxodon namadicus
Palaeoloxodon namadicus was an extinct elephant species that lived during the Pleistocene in South Asia. It is known from fossil remains found mainly in the Indian subcontinent. It is considered one of the largest known terrestrial mammals, although exact size estimates remain uncertain because complete skeletons are rare. It had massive limb bones and large tusks and probably fed on a variety of vegetation.
How Are Elephants Protected?
Elephant conservation requires several approaches working together. Protecting forests, grasslands, and wildlife corridors helps elephants move between feeding and breeding areas. Anti-poaching programs help reduce illegal killing for ivory. Conservation organizations and governments also work to reduce human-elephant conflict in areas where farms and settlements overlap with elephant habitat.

Are All Elephant Names Actually Species?
African Savanna Elephant, African Forest Elephant, and Asian Elephant are living species. Indian Elephant, Sri Lankan Elephant, Sumatran Elephant, and Bornean Elephant are classifications within the Asian Elephant rather than four additional living species. There are also many extinct proboscideans, including mammoths and other ancient relatives.

Palaeoloxodon Naumanni
Palaeoloxodon naumanni was an extinct elephant species that lived in Japan and parts of East Asia during the Pleistocene. It was related to the straight-tusked elephants and had a large body with long tusks. Fossils have been found at several Japanese sites. It lived in forests and open environments and probably fed on leaves, grasses, branches, fruits, and other vegetation available in its habitat.
Stegodon
Stegodon was an extinct genus of elephant relatives that lived mainly across Asia during the Miocene and Pleistocene. Its members had large bodies, long tusks, and distinctive molar teeth with numerous ridges. Different Stegodon species occupied forests, grasslands, and other habitats. They were herbivores that likely ate grasses, leaves, branches, fruits, and other plant material, depending on their environment.
Stegodon Orientalis | Types of Elephant
Stegodon orientalis was an extinct elephant species that lived in parts of East and Southeast Asia during the Pleistocene. It had a large body, long tusks, and ridged molar teeth typical of Stegodon. Fossils have been found in China and surrounding regions. It inhabited different environments and was a herbivore, feeding on grasses, leaves, branches, fruits, and other vegetation available in its surroundings.
Stegodon Trigonocephalus
Stegodon trigonocephalus was an extinct elephant species that lived on Java during the Pleistocene. It belonged to the genus Stegodon, known for its distinctive ridged molars and large tusks. Fossil remains have been discovered at several Indonesian sites. Like other elephant relatives, it was herbivorous and probably consumed grasses, leaves, branches, fruits, and other plant material depending on the habitats it occupied.
Gomphotherium
Gomphotherium was an extinct genus of proboscideans that lived mainly during the Miocene. It had a long lower jaw and four tusks, including a pair extending from the lower jaw. Its fossils have been found across parts of Europe, Asia, Africa, and North America. Gomphotherium lived in various environments and ate vegetation, including leaves, grasses, fruits, and other available plant material.
Deinotherium
Deinotherium was an extinct genus of large proboscideans that lived from the Miocene into the early Pleistocene. It had a distinctive pair of downward-curving tusks attached to the lower jaw rather than the upper jaw. Its fossils have been found in Africa, Europe, and Asia. Deinotherium was a herbivore that probably used its trunk and tusks while feeding on leaves, branches, and other vegetation.
Anancus
Anancus was an extinct genus of proboscideans that lived mainly during the Miocene and Pliocene. It had a large body and exceptionally long, nearly straight upper tusks. Its fossils have been discovered in Africa, Europe, and Asia. Unlike some earlier proboscideans, it had no lower tusks. Anancus was herbivorous and likely fed on grasses, leaves, branches, fruits, and other plant material.
Platybelodon
Platybelodon was an extinct genus of proboscideans that lived during the Miocene. It had a long lower jaw with flattened lower tusks and a broad, shovel-like structure. These unusual teeth may have helped it gather or process vegetation from wet or soft environments. Fossils have been found across parts of Asia, Europe, and North America. It was a plant-eating member of the proboscidean group.
Amebelodon | Types of Elephant
Amebelodon was an extinct genus of shovel-tusked proboscideans that lived mainly during the Miocene and early Pliocene. It had elongated lower jaws and flattened lower tusks that formed a shovel-like shape. Its fossils have been found in North America and other regions. Amebelodon lived in environments near water and probably used its unusual tusks and trunk to gather aquatic plants, grasses, roots, and other vegetation.
Cuvieronius
Cuvieronius was an extinct genus of proboscideans that lived in North and South America during the Pleistocene. It had a large body, long tusks, and distinctive spiral grooves on its tusks in some specimens. These animals inhabited a variety of environments and were herbivores. Their diet likely included grasses, leaves, fruits, and other vegetation available in the forests, grasslands, and open habitats where they lived.
Notiomastodon
Notiomastodon was an extinct genus of proboscideans that lived in South America during the Pleistocene. It was a large, elephant-like herbivore with long tusks and a robust body. Fossils have been discovered in several South American countries. It occupied different habitats, including open areas and forests, and probably ate grasses, leaves, fruits, roots, and other vegetation depending on local environmental conditions.
Moeritherium
Moeritherium was an extinct, early proboscidean that lived during the Eocene in northern Africa. It was much smaller than modern elephants and had a low, barrel-shaped body with a short trunk-like upper lip. It probably lived near water in swampy environments. Its teeth suggest a plant-based diet, and it likely fed on soft aquatic vegetation, grasses, leaves, and other plants growing around wetlands.
Palaeomastodon
Palaeomastodon was an extinct early proboscidean that lived during the late Eocene and early Oligocene in Africa. It had a large body, a relatively short trunk, and tusks in both the upper and lower jaws. Its fossils are especially associated with the Fayum region of Egypt. It probably lived in environments near water and fed on leaves, grasses, roots, and other vegetation.
Primelephas
Primelephas was an extinct genus of early elephant relatives that lived in Africa during the late Miocene and Pliocene. It is important in elephant evolution because it is closely related to the lineage leading toward modern elephants and mammoths. Primelephas had tusks and a trunk like later proboscideans. It was herbivorous and likely fed on grasses, leaves, fruits, branches, and other vegetation.
Frequently Asked Questions of Elephants
How many elephant species are alive today?
There are three living elephant species: the African Savanna Elephant, African Forest Elephant, and Asian Elephant.
What are the two types of African elephants?
The two recognized African species are the African Savanna Elephant (Loxodonta africana) and the African Forest Elephant (Loxodonta cyclotis).
What is the largest type of elephant?
The African Savanna Elephant is generally considered the largest living elephant species and the largest living land mammal.
Are African and Asian elephants different species?
Yes. African Savanna and African Forest Elephants belong to the genus Loxodonta, while the Asian Elephant belongs to the genus Elephas.
Which elephant is critically endangered?
The African Forest Elephant is currently classified as Critically Endangered by the IUCN. African Savanna Elephants and Asian Elephants are classified as Endangered.
Are mammoths a type of elephants?
Mammoths were extinct members of the elephant family and close relatives of living elephants, but they are not living elephant types. They should therefore be discussed separately as extinct elephant relatives.
